Shazam announces user statistics for the UK Sound of 2009

Millions tag their top acts for 2009

London, 19th January 2009 - Shazam, the world's leading mobile music discovery provider, today announced its prediction for acts to watch in 2009. Unlike the BBC's "Sound of 2009" poll and other subjective opinions on the acts to watch in 2009, Shazam's millions of users have already spoken via the acts they have been tagging as the ones most likely to do well in 2009. The people would appear to both agree and disagree with the pundits.

In contrast to Little Boots topping the BBC's poll, Kid Cudi sits atop Shazam's sound of 2009 with the runaway success of his 'Day & Night' track and his guest spot on Kanye West's album. Lady Gaga also gets in high at number two with 'Just Dance' resonating with the public.

However, the BBC and Shazam users do agree on some of the acts set to do well in 2009, with both listing Australian psychedelic rock/electronica outfit Empire Of The Sun, doom rock merchants White Lies and art pop singer Florence and the Machine. Little Boots also looks to be one to watch in 2009, although she is further down Shazam's list at number nine.

Acts off the BBC's radar but hitting home with Shazam's users include Mark Ronson's cohort Daniel Merriweather, alternative rocker's Airborne Toxic Event, UK grime collective Boy Better Know and Jamaican dancehall crooner Mavado.

Shazam's Head of Music, Will Mills, says; "With music discovery services like Shazam, music fans are making their voices heard and are as important as the critics in deciding which acts will do the business in 2009. Indeed Shazam's users do validate some of the critic's choices but they also show much more diversity in the acts they're tipping for success."

Shazam's Sound of 2009:

1Kid Cudi
2Lady Gaga
3Empire of the Sun
4Daniel Merriweather
5White Lies
6The Airborne Toxic Event
7Florence and the Machine
8Boy Better Know
9Little Boots
10Mavado

Shazam's user statistics on the Sound of 2008 picked out The Ting Tings and Duffy as the two top acts to watch.
